Supposedly cache barrier instructions on the R10000 are relativly cheap but so far due to the lack of a need we haven't actually benchmarked that. As I recall the issue loads would still fetch the line from memory which in case of DMA buffers could result in stale data unless a cache flush is being performed after the DMA as well. Ralf
